Part 3 Device System Operation
When the disinfection equipment is worked indoors, the UV light will cause harm to
the human body, so it is necessary to place the Sensor-controlled safety sign outside the
room to warn the personnel not to approach. At the same time, as an accessory product,
the Sensor-controlled safety sign needs to work with the disinfection equipment, which
can intelligently feedback the various states of the disinfection equipment. Use the
Sensor-controlled safety sign according to the following steps:
Step 1 Install 8*AA batteries
Step 2 Place the Sensor-controlled safety sign at the door of the room to be
disinfected, and turn on the Sensor-controlled safety sign switch
Step 3 Through the web software to match the Sensor-controlled safety sign with the
designated disinfected equipment
Step 4 After disinfection, close the Sensor-controlled safety sign

4.1 Caution
•Alert people who want to enter the disinfection room with a striking Sensor-controlled
safety sign "caution, UV infection do not enter!"
•The size of the Sensor-controlled safety sign is "524 (L) * 322 (W) * 752 (H) mm",
which can prevent people from bypassing the Sensor-controlled safety sign and
entering the room to be disinfected; the Sensor-controlled safety sign is 2.2kg, and
its weight can avoid shaking itself
4.2 Switch
The Sensor-controlled safety sign has several switches, which are described as follows:
•Sensor-controlled safety sign switch (toggle switch on / off). The switch of the main
power supply of the Sensor-controlled safety sign. Power on after opening. At this
time, the Sensor-controlled safety sign only indicates the status of the disinfection
equipment that has been paired successfully
•Intrusion detection switch (tap switch mode)
Press and hold for 3 seconds, and the buzzer will sound three times to turn on
the intrusion detection. At this time, the Sensor-controlled safety sign has the
ability to send touch alarm
Long press for 3 seconds and the buzzer will sound to turn off the intrusion
detection
•Paired mode switch (tap switch mode). Press three times continuously (interval <
0.5s), the Sensor-controlled safety sign will enter the pairing state, and the
disinfection equipment will scan, select and match in the setting interface
4.3 Intrusion detection and disinfection device state
indicator
•Intrusion detection. When the Sensor-controlled safety sign is detected to be moved,

UBTECH Sensor-controlled safety sign USER MANUAL
UBTECH ROBOTICS CORP LTD
the disinfection equipment will be informed in time to stop disinfect. After the
disinfection equipment stops disinfect, the status of the equipment will be fed back to
the Sensor-controlled safety sign
•The disinfection equipment status includes the non safety state of normal operation
of the disinfection equipment, the safe state after the disinfection equipment is shut
down, the non safety state when the disinfection equipment fails, and the state of
disconnection from the disinfection equipment

4.5 Bluetooth pairing (Web)
As the peripheral equipment of disinfection equipment, the Sensor-controlled safety
sign should be paired through Bluetooth. The [peripheral] tab of [system settings]
provides the pairing of Sensor-controlled safety sign.
•One disinfection device allows multiple Bluetooth Sensor-controlled safety signs
•The communication distance of the Sensor-controlled safety sign is not less than 20

UBTECH Sensor-controlled safety sign USER MANUAL
UBTECH ROBOTICS CORP LTD
meters, which can block a conventional room door (such as hotel or hospital room
door)
•Users can upgrade firmware via Bluetooth OTA
•Pairing steps of Sensor-controlled safety sign:
When it is not paired, it will prompt "there is no pairing Sensor-controlled safety
sign"
Find the Bluetooth device and list the devices that can be found after searching
for a period of time
Note: the Bluetooth MAC address is pasted on the body of the caution for user
identification. At the same time, the interface prompts the user that "the Sensor-controlled
safety sign should open the pairing mode".
Start pairing and select any Sensor-controlled safety sign. If it is successful, it
will prompt "the selected Sensor-controlled safety sign are paired successfully!"
Otherwise, it will prompt "matching of the selected Sensor-controlled safety sign
failed!"
If the pairing is successful, the information of the paired Sensor-controlled safety
sign will be displayed. At the same time, the paired disinfection devices
broadcast voice
Continue to add Sensor-controlled safety sign, up to 4 at present. Or you can
cancel the pairing with the Sensor-controlled safety sign

5.2 Maintenance
Warning:
Do not use abrasives, aerosols, alcohol containing liquids or other liquids to clean
the Sensor-controlled safety sign, because they may contain flammable substances or
may damage the plastic shell, cloth and printed characters on the cloth. Do not spray or
spray the Sensor-controlled safety sign with water or other liquids. Please keep the
Sensor-controlled safety sign dry.
Follow the steps below to ensure safety and avoid damaging the Sensor-controlled
safety sign:
1. Press the power button on the side of the main control box to close the caution
sign;
2. Open the back cover of the main control box and take out the battery to ensure
that the access plate is completely powered off;
3. Clean the outside of the Sensor-controlled safety sign with a soft damp cloth;
4. Wipe the outside of the Sensor-controlled safety sign thoroughly with a soft dry
cloth;
5. Check whether the Sensor-controlled safety sign is dry.

Part 6 Reference
6.1 Device Specification
Dimensions
Size 524(L) * 322(W) * 752(H) mm
Weight 2.2kg
Operating temperature 0℃~40℃
Operating humidity 10 to 85% relative humidity (indoor use only)
Storage temperature -40℃~60℃
Storage humidity ≤95% (non-condensation indoor only)
Device Body Material Stainless steel,PC+ABS
Device System
Main Processor Nordic nRF52833, 512KB Flash, 128K Ram
Wireless Module Bluetooth 5.0
Acoustics 1x 2W Buzzer
LED LED * 2
Button Mode Button * 1
Switch Power Switch * 1
Power Supply
Input Voltage 6V DC
Current 20mA
